The massive viewership numbers have translated into a robust creator economy. Brands have shifted substantial advertising budgets from traditional television networks to digital video campaigns. Hyper-localized influencer marketing is now standard practice, with brands leveraging micro-influencers who speak local dialects (such as Javanese, Sundanese, or Balinese) to build authentic consumer trust. xbokep
Despite the digital surge, traditional television remains a cornerstone of daily life, and the Indonesian soap opera, or , continues to be a ratings king. Shows like RCTI's "Terikat Janji" and INDOSIAR's "Istiqomah Cinta" consistently secure top spots in national TV ratings, competing fiercely with primetime programs. These dramas, known for their emotional plots and family-centric themes, have a loyal, massive audience that traditional ratings panels continue to track closely.

Channels like Safari Urban Legend and Kisah Tanah Merdeka produce hyper-realistic, shaky-cam docu-dramas about local ghosts (gendruwo, pocong, tuyul) and urban legends. These are not cheap jump scares; they are meticulously researched folklore, often filmed in abandoned pasar (markets) or railway crossings. Music videos are a massive traffic driver. Specifically, —a modern, fast-paced subgenre of traditional Indonesian folk music—dominates the trending tabs. Artists like Denny Caknan and Happy Asmara pull in staggering view counts by blending traditional Javanese lyrics with infectious, danceable beats. Gaming and Esports Streaming
